BALR - Range report - not great….

The BALR does fire fine, the three rounds I got through…. The bolt retainer is the week link - it broke on cycling out the third and in with the forth round, and the bolt carrier partially popped out the back. No big deal but I couldn’t fix at range. I saw someone else complaining about this part - it’s very small and fragile. I had dry cycled it and with snap caps a hundred times or more with no issues. I might be more aggressive with the bolt at the range I guess, but either way, it’s going to happen. Easy to reprint, but I’ll have to take off the optic and pic rail to reinstall, assuming when it got pulled out from the wrong side, that there was no damage to the upper receiver that will require a reprint. I going to try to make this part from a block of aluminum. It’s a tiny 3d part so can’t SCS it. Nothing to do with operation, but I regret doing the integral rear bipod. They are flimsy and don’t really lock in place well. If I had known, I would have just printed the medium sized hand guard. They look cool, but that’s about it. I’ll be shooting with the handguard on a pile of range bags

Temu SPR build

This build started when i saw a BCA complete upper with 20” hbar for $190 ish.

I enjoy SPRs so I thought “how bad can it be for under 200 bucks?”. I decided my goal was to make the cheapest SPR possible.

Hadnt shot it in a while, so took it to the range today along with my WOA 18” SPR. Everything was at 100 yards

Cold barrel group for each, then moved to smaller dots. Most of the rounds are 62 gr reloads. I ran a 5 round group in each gun with 77gr reloads. Both had bipods and rear bags.

Imagine my surprise that I got a 0.75” 5 round group with the BCA vs WOA 0.94” with the 77gr

Not sure what is up with the WOA today, maybe didnt like this batch of reloads, normally it averages 1.5” groups and does way better than todays performance.

Build:
BCA 20” complete upper 1:8 223 wylde
Super lower
Km tactical flat face trigger
Reduced power springs by dirty bird
H3 buffer
Amazon bipod
Duramag 20 rounders
Monstrum 5-25 scope (this really sucks will need to be swapped asap)

Everything together was under $450, optic included.

You can also see my Slap Stick on the side, easy to manipulate bolt with left hand.

Also dont take this post as a ringing endorsement for BCA. I rolled the dice and won the lottery but they do not have the best reputation so I am not sure my results are repeatable.
